User Experience & Interface
Let’s talk about the user interface for a bit. YouTube keeps things pretty straightforward, which is something I appreciate. The homepage is personalized, showing you recommendations based on your previous views. The search functionality is top-notch, and the app is quite responsive, even on slower connections. Plus, the dark mode is a lifesaver for those late-night binge sessions!
Another cool feature is the "Subscriptions" tab. It lets you keep track of your favorite channels without missing a beat. And if you're someone like me who enjoys the occasional rabbit hole dive, the "Up Next" feature is both a blessing and a curse. It's so easy to keep watching video after video without even realizing where the time went!

Monetization & YouTube Premium
Now, let’s talk dollars and cents. YouTube offers monetization options for creators through ads, memberships, and Super Chats. It’s a great way for creators to earn a living doing what they love. However, for viewers who prefer an ad-free experience, YouTube Premium is the way to go. It offers not just ad-free streaming, but also offline downloads and access to YouTube Music. Personally, I think it’s worth the price if you’re a heavy user.
And let’s not forget about YouTube Shorts, the platform’s answer to TikTok. While it’s still finding its footing, it’s a fun way to engage with quick, snappy content.
